A double-glazed window that has been misted up is usually due to a breakdown of the hermetic seal. This is where the seal around the edges of the sealed unit has perished, allowing humidity to enter between the glass panes. This does not mean you'll need to replace the window, as the frame is still in good condition.

The most commonly used solution for a window that is misting is to replace the sealed unit, which is less expensive than replacing glass in double glazing (galpaodainformatica.com.br) the entire window. In addition, it is an excellent opportunity to upgrade the glass to energy-efficient glass that is A-rated to save even more money on heating costs.
